Speaking Up for Solutions

Autism Speaks was formed to promote solutions, across the spectrum and throughout the lifespan, for the needs of individuals with autism and their families. Since 2010, Goodwin has donated over 1,550 hours of  legal counsel to help Autism Speaks provide critical services and in furtherance of its mission.

Challenge

Dedicated to providing education, advocacy and support, Autism Speaks is increasing understanding and acceptance of people with autism spectrum disorder, advancing research into causes and better interventions for autism spectrum disorder and related conditions, and in providing resources to help support those affected by autism. Goodwin partners, associates and staff have stepped up to provide guidance to help Autism Speaks fulfill its mission.

Approach

Beginning with a relationship initiated by Goodwin partners John LeClaire and John Ferguson in 2010, over the past seven years, more than 70 Goodwin attorneys and professional staff members have devoted more than 1,550 hours of service to Autism Speaks. The work has ranged from preparing the Individualized Education Program (IEP) Guide (one of Autism Speaks’ core free tool-kits), to negotiating the relationship with Google for the cloud-based MSSNG genome sequencing program (the world’s largest open-access genomic database for autism research), to countless corporate sponsorships and relationships, to labor, employment, real estate, transactional, life sciences and litigation matters.

Outcome

Since its founding in 2005, Autism Speaks has since merged with three leading autism groups and grown into a powerful advocacy organization with nearly 300 employees, half a million volunteers and partnerships in more than 70 countries. “It’s been a great opportunity to bring the resources of a firm like this to bear for a client that’s really doing great work on a number of different fronts,” Ferguson said.
